Lack of Smoking Policy and Unsafe Resident Smoking Practices

Kern Valley Healthcare District Dp SnfLake Isabella, California Survey Completed on 04-23-2026

Summary

The facility failed to develop and implement a policy and procedure for smoking for one resident who was allowed to smoke. During an observation on 4/21/26 at 11:06 a.m. in the courtyard outside the activities room, the resident used a lighter to light a cigarette while her procedure mask was pulled down around her chin, and no facility staff were present. No ashtrays were within reach, and there was a no smoking sign on the activities room door. During another observation at 11:20 a.m. the same day, the resident extinguished her cigarette on the side of a cup hanging on her wheelchair and placed the cigarette butt in the cup, then lit another cigarette while still wearing the mask pulled down around her chin, again with no staff present. On 4/23/26 at 9:25 a.m., the resident was observed lying in bed with eyes closed and not responding when greeted. Her wheelchair had a cup attached to the side containing a cigarette case, and the case contained a lighter. During a concurrent observation and interview, a CNA stated the resident was not allowed to keep the lighter and was supposed to give it back to staff after smoking. An RN stated the resident sometimes did not return the lighter and staff had to look for it, and that the resident sometimes used the cup on the wheelchair for cigarette butts instead of the facility-provided ashtrays. The RN also stated the facility had multiple confused residents who liked to wander and were at risk of injury due to access to the lighter. The DON stated there was no policy outlining expectations for residents who were allowed to smoke, and that the resident was expected to smoke in the designated smoking area, use facility-provided ashtrays, and return the lighter to the charge nurse to be locked up until needed again.

Failure to Complete Quarterly Smoking Evaluations
D
F0926 F926: Have policies on smoking.
Short Summary

Failure to Complete Quarterly Smoking Evaluations: The facility did not ensure that five residents with schizophrenia or paranoid schizophrenia were evaluated quarterly for smoking as required by policy. Their most recent smoking evaluations were past due, and RN and DON interviews confirmed the evaluations should have been completed every three months and reviewed by the IDT.

Smoking Policy Not Consistently Enforced
D
F0926 F926: Have policies on smoking.
Short Summary

Smoking Policy Not Consistently Enforced: A cognitively intact resident with COPD was allowed independent leave to smoke off-property, but staff did not consistently collect his cigarettes and lighter or prevent him from keeping smoking materials on his person inside the facility. The resident reported inconsistent enforcement of leave-of-absence hours, and an observation found cigarettes and a lighter stored on his walker.

Smoking Policy Not Followed
E
F0926 F926: Have policies on smoking.
Short Summary

A resident with intact cognition and physical weakness was allowed to keep cigarettes on his person, but the facility had no documented safe smoking evaluation, no smoking care plan area, and no smoking assessments in the EMR. Staff also observed smoking in a no-smoking area on the back patio, where no-smoking signs, an ashtray, and a trash can were present, while the ADM stated residents were allowed to smoke unsupervised and smoking items were found in non-designated areas.

Smoking Policy Not Followed for Resident Using Cannabis Near Facility Entrance
D
F0926 F926: Have policies on smoking.
Short Summary

A resident was observed smoking cannabis about 10 feet from a building entrance in a non-designated area, despite the facility’s smoking policy and THC policy prohibiting cannabis use on the property. The resident was cognitively intact, had diagnoses including CKD, GERD, neuropathy, MDD, and edema, and stated he/she obtained marijuana from an outside source and would not stop using it. Staff interviews showed inconsistent understanding of smoking locations, and the resident’s care plan documented tobacco dependence and prior cannabis use on facility grounds.

Smoking Area Trash Placed in Butt Can
D
F0926 F926: Have policies on smoking.
Short Summary

A facility failed to enforce smoking safety policies in the smoking area for halls C/D when a red butt can was found holding cigarette butts plus a plastic wrapper, gloves, and a plastic wrist band. The Housekeeping Supervisor, ADON, DON, RDO, Administrator, and Maintenance Supervisor all stated that the red cans were for cigarette butts only and that trash belonged in the trash can, while the Maintenance Supervisor said staff were always putting trash in the smoking can and a sign had been posted to remind staff.

Smoking Break Schedule Not Followed
E
F0926 F926: Have policies on smoking.
Short Summary

Smoking Break Schedule Not Followed: A facility failed to enforce its smoking schedule and related smoking policies for residents who smoked. Several residents were scheduled for a 10:30 A.M. supervised smoke break, but they were still inside during observation and did not go out until later. Interviews showed the SS created the schedule, but staffing changes were not communicated timely, and staff reported the smoke breaks were often late.
